About

Meir Pachter is a scholar working on Aerospace Engineering, Control and Systems Engineering and Artificial Intelligence. According to data from OpenAlex, Meir Pachter has authored 274 papers receiving a total of 3.9k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 177 papers in Aerospace Engineering, 80 papers in Control and Systems Engineering and 42 papers in Artificial Intelligence. Recurrent topics in Meir Pachter’s work include Guidance and Control Systems (128 papers), Military Defense Systems Analysis (60 papers) and Advanced Control Systems Optimization (34 papers). Meir Pachter is often cited by papers focused on Guidance and Control Systems (128 papers), Military Defense Systems Analysis (60 papers) and Advanced Control Systems Optimization (34 papers). Meir Pachter collaborates with scholars based in United States, South Africa and Israel. Meir Pachter's co-authors include Phillip Chandler, Eloy García, David W. Casbeer, J. D'Azzo, Steven Rasmussen, Siva S. Banda, Mark Mears, Zongli Lin, P. Chandler and Wayne M. Getz and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Automatic Control, Automatica and European Journal of Operational Research.
